About Maochen Li

Maochen Li is a scholar working on Infectious Diseases, Epidemiology, Obstetrics and Gynecology,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Ecology, having authored 21 papers that have together received 642 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include SARS-CoV-2 and COVID-19 Research (8 papers), COVID-19 Impact on Reproduction (4 papers), Respiratory viral infections research (3 papers), COVID-19 Clinical Research Studies (3 papers), Infant Nutrition and Health (2 papers), Cardiovascular Disease and Adiposity (2 papers),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(2 papers) and SARS-CoV-2 detection and testing (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Infectious Diseases (319 citations), Health (42 citations), Obstetrics and Gynecology (31 citations), Molecular Medicine (22 citations) and Microbiology (21 citations). Maochen Li has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Frequent co-authors include Huahao Fan, Yigang Tong, Lihua Song, Lili Tian, Junfen Fan, Zehan Pang, Fuxing Lou, Tianqi Huang, Xiaoping An and Shaozhou Zhu. Their work appears in journals such as Signal Transduction and Targeted Therapy, Frontiers in Immunology, Frontiers in Medicine, BMC Cardiovascular Disorders and Journal of Medical Virology.
